What is educational therapy & how is it different from tutoring?
Educational therapy is a specialized, individualized approach that addresses not only what a student needs to learn, but how they learn, and the underlying cognitive needs. At EmilyDiana Collective we integrate evidence-based methods (for example, structured literacy aligned with the science of reading) and tailor instruction for students with learning differences, attention challenges, or academic gaps. Traditional tutoring often focuses on content review and homework help; educational therapy digs deeper to build skills, strategies, and self-advocacy, so the student becomes more independent
